#70665f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#70665f is composed of 43.9% red, 40%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.9% magenta, 15.2%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 24.7 degrees, a saturation of 8.2% and a lightness of 40.6%. #70665f color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ccbe with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#70665f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060505 is the darkest color, while #fbfb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#70665f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686767 is the less saturated color, while #c85707 is the most saturated one.
